Kiran Kanwar was India's first female golf teaching professional and a winner of the 1983 All India Ladies' Open Amateur National Championship. She is widely researched with a BS (Physics & Math), a MS (Sports Science & Nutrition) and a PhD candidate (Biomechanics, Structural & Rehabilitation Sciences, & Sports Coaching Theory). She shares her "Optimal Performance Swing" and shares proven theories on how you can use it to shallow your downswing, approach the ball from the inside, make improved and consistent contact. Further, she advises how this all will straighten a slice and eliminate one side of the golf course. Simplify your golf swing and eliminate unnecessary movements while improving your ball-striking with Kiran Kanwar.
